Latest Patents
Among Carlson's notable recent inventions is the "Flow assisted anti-fouling geometries for compact heat exchangers." This patent proposes an innovative header design for heat exchangers that enhances the efficiency of fluid distribution through multiple channels. The design includes a filter element that works to remove particulates and fouling material from the fluid stream, allowing for a 'clean in place' cleaning method without needing to disconnect the system components.
Another significant invention is the "Frangible-soluble casting cores and methods of making the same." This patent describes a casting technique whereby conventional methods such as direct liquid metal infiltration and centrifugal casting can be used. This innovation aims to improve the efficiency of manufacturing processes in casting applications.
